sysctl

OpenBSDで論理プロセッサを無効にする方法は?
sysctl

OpenBSDで論理プロセッサを無効にする方法は?

私たち全員が知っているように、OpenBSDはハイパースレッディングはデフォルトで無効になっています。。しかし、htop16個のCPU(8個はオンライン、8個はオフライン)を表示すると、画面上の余分なスペースを占めるので、あまり有益ではありません。 また、sysctl16個の論理CPUが表示されます。これは私には理解できません。ハイパースレッディングが無効になっている場合は8コア8スレッドプロセッサであるため、8つの物理/論理CPUを表示する必要があります。 $ sysctl hw hw.machine=amd64 hw.model=AMD Ryzen 7...

Admin

PHP-FPMは定期的にOOMを呼び出します。
sysctl

PHP-FPMは定期的にOOMを呼び出します。

最新の1GBのメモリを備えたインスタンスを使用していますEC2。私は最新のwithを使用して画像をアップロードして変換するためにwithを使用しています。私の設定:t4g.microarm64ubuntunginxPHP-FPMimage.interventionGDPHP_FPM pm = static pm.max_children = 1 pm.max_requests = 300 そしてphp.ini: max_execution_time = 5 memory_limit = 100M opcache.enable = 1 opcache.jit...

Admin

dockerはホストのsysctl値を使用しません。
sysctl

dockerはホストのsysctl値を使用しません。

私はoraclelinux 9 LinuxホストでLinuxコンテナを実行しています(ホスト自体は仮想マシンで実行されています)。 dockerはどこからsysctlパラメータを読みますか? dockerが使用するデフォルトのsysctl値を変更してみました。 これを行うために、ホストシステムで次の手順を実行しました。 sysctl -w net.ip4.udp_rmem_min=64000000 sysctl -a | grep ip4.udp_rmem_min-> 64000000 systemctl restart docker(ただ保存しよう...

Admin

systemctl --type=service および systemctl list-unit-files はすべてのサービスを表示しません。
sysctl

systemctl --type=service および systemctl list-unit-files はすべてのサービスを表示しません。

ManjaroホストとDebian Serverホストにwireguardをインストールしました。 次のコマンドが表示されます。ラインバッカーManjaroの結果にはありますが、Debianサーバーには何もありませんが、ラインバッカーDebianサーバーで実行する必要があります。 systemctl --type=service systemctl --type=service --all systemctl list-unit-files Debian サーバーがフットプリントを表示しない理由ラインバッカー?そしておそらく他の人も提供する私も見ることがで...

Admin

sysctlを使用してLinuxサブインターフェイスでIPv6を有効にする方法は?
sysctl

sysctlを使用してLinuxサブインターフェイスでIPv6を有効にする方法は?

次を試しましたが、次の sysctl -w net.ipv6.conf.Ethernet1.200.disable_ipv6=0エラーが発生しました。 sysctl: cannot stat /proc/sys/net/ipv6/conf/Ethernet1/200/disable_ipv6: No such file or directory 理想的には変更を試みる必要があります。 /proc/sys/net/ipv6/conf/Ethernet1.200/disable_ipv6 しかし、実際にはそうではありません。 私はこれを使用しましたが、ec...

Admin

システムパラメータを設定するsysctlオプションの違い
sysctl

システムパラメータを設定するsysctlオプションの違い

sysctlカスタムパラメータをロードする2つの異なるコマンドをオンラインで表示しました。 sysctl --system sysctl -p これら2つのコマンド間に違いはありますか?私が投稿した2番目のエントリは、ロードするファイルのパスを使用できることを知っていますが、ファイルが指定されていない場合はすべてがロードされます。 ...

Admin

構成ファイルの等価編集
sysctl

構成ファイルの等価編集

たとえば、構成ファイルを編集するときには、等しく更新するのが/etc/sysctl.conf便利な場合がよくあります。つまり、スクリプトを複数回実行すると、構成変更の項目が複数表示されません。 実際、このような状況が発生したときに、ansibleマルチレベルプレイブックで上記のファイルを編集する必要がありました。しかし、問題は、後で失敗した場合はプレイブックを再実行する必要があるということです。言い換えれば、更新コマンドが複数回実行され、更新が等しくない場合、重複が発生する可能性があります。 もしそうなら、問題はこれらの設定ファイルをすばらしい方法で更新する...

Admin

sysctlパラメータ設定と比較してgrubブートパラメータを設定するときに直接マッピングがないと思いますか?
sysctl

sysctlパラメータ設定と比較してgrubブートパラメータを設定するときに直接マッピングがないと思いますか?

sysctlパラメータとは異なり、grub起動パラメータを設定するときに直接マッピングはありません。 私の問題は、同じ機能/設定に設定できますが、変数名が異なる2つの場所(grubとsysctl config)があることです。 panic_on_oopsたとえば、grubパラメーターではこれを見ることはできません。 引用: https://www.kernel.org/doc/html/v6.0/admin-guide/kernel-parameters.html 他の例、 kernel.panicたとえば、grubコマンドでsysctlを設定して、grub...

Admin

sysctlパラメーターが仮想マシンで機能していないようです。
sysctl

sysctlパラメーターが仮想マシンで機能していないようです。

サーバーのパフォーマンスを調整しようとしています。そのためにnet.core.somaxconn、net.ipv4.tcp_max_syn_backlogなどのいくつかのsysctlパラメータをテストしたいと思いますnet.core.netdev_max_backlog。 私の設定は次のとおりです。 nginx dockerコンテナを実行しているサーバーは、4vCPU静的ページを提供するテストWebサーバーとして機能します。 One 16vCPU、one 8vCPU、one4vCPUロードジェネレータとしてnginxサーバーでフレームワークを使用していま...

Admin

/dev/hugepagesの権限をどのように変更しますか?
sysctl

/dev/hugepagesの権限をどのように変更しますか?

/dev/hugepages次のファイルを開き、巨大なページを割り当てるアプリケーションがあります。現在はルートが必要です。 権限をどのように変更しますか? F38によって自動的にインストールされます。 #/usr/lib/systemd/system/dev-hugepages.mount # SPDX-License-Identifier: LGPL-2.1-or-later # # This file is part of systemd. # # systemd is free software; you can redistribute i...

Admin

Linuxでpid_maxとthread-maxの両方が必要なのはなぜですか?
sysctl

Linuxでpid_maxとthread-maxの両方が必要なのはなぜですか?

/proc/sys/kernel/pid_maxの違いを理解してください/proc/sys/kernel/threads-max。答えに良い説明があります pid_max、ulimit -u、thread_maxの違いを理解する: /proc/sys/kernel/pid_max特定の時間に実行できるプロセスの最大数とは関係ありません。実際、これはカーネルが割り当てることができる最大の数値プロセス識別子です。 Linuxカーネルでは、プロセスとスレッドは同じです。カーネルはこれを同じ方法で処理します。これらはすべてtask_structデータ構造のスロット...

Admin

IP転送を有効にした後のネットワーク動作
sysctl

IP転送を有効にした後のネットワーク動作

私のコンピュータに2つのネットワークカードがあるとしましょう。これを行うと、sysctl -w net.ipv4.ip_forward=1ネットワークスタックはすぐにあるネットワークカードから別のネットワークカードにパケットを転送し始めますか?一種のスイッチ/ブリッジのようですか?それとも、FORWARDその中のチェーンによって異なりますかiptables? (ポリシーDROP/ ACCEPT) ...

Admin

net.ipv4.route.flush 実行のリスクは何ですか?
sysctl

net.ipv4.route.flush 実行のリスクは何ですか?

AWSを介してLinuxボックスを設定してナビゲートしていますsysctl。実行すると、そのアドレスを参照するパスがすでにマシンにip routeあることがわかります。169.X.X.X 質問: systctl -w net.ipv4.route.flush=1効果は何ですか? systctl -w net.ipv4.route.flush=1AWS Linuxインスタンスが期待どおりに機能するために必要なデフォルトのボックス/構成はめちゃくちゃになりますか? ...

Admin